How much does it cost to rent a home in Lower Allston?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Lower Allston 2 Bedroom Condos for Rent | $3,294 | $1,500 | $7,195 |
| Lower Allston 3 Bedroom Condos for Rent | $4,026 | $1,225 | $10,000+ |
| Lower Allston 4 Bedroom Condos for Rent | $4,396 | $850 | $8,000 |
| Lower Allston 5 Bedroom Condos for Rent | $4,614 | $1,230 | $9,000 |
| Lower Allston 6 Bedroom Condos for Rent | $4,082 | $925 | $10,000+ |
| Lower Allston 7 Bedroom Condos for Rent | $1,652 | $1,030 | $7,000 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Lower Allston
What type of rentals are currently available in Lower Allston?
There are currently 863 Apartments for Rent in Lower Allston, MA with pricing that ranges from $950 to $14,114. There are also 1365 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Lower Allston ranging from $850 to $13,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Lower Allston?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Lower Allston ranges from $850 to $13,000 with an average monthly rent of $3,535.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Lower Allston?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Lower Allston range from $1,100 to $9,000,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,225 to $11,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$850 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,300.
